What they do
A Sales Event Specialist plans, organizes and runs marketing events to generate product sales and promote interest in a product, service or brand. Develops ideas for events, plans event venues and activities, coordinates marketing and publicity, and meets with customers during events. May work for a company or a marketing firm.

RIAC holds premier auctions at least three (3) times each year; working as a phone bidder for our premier auctions requires availability from 7:00 a.m. - 7:00 p.m., Friday through Sunday. What does a typical workday for premier auction look like? Phone Bidders can expect the following: Primary responsibility: Manage inbound phone bidding calls, placing bids on behalf of clients while delivering accurate product information and excellent service.
Remain attentive and engaged at assigned stations during the auction preview, interacting with clients and addressing their needs.
Assist with auction setup and teardown, including positioning equipment, display racks, and auction items with care.
Support general cleaning and maintenance to keep the auction area organized and presentable.
Help with kitchen and bar operations, including serving food and beverages as needed.
